Hi there,
you can use any S-Video cable without a problem
We have tested several setup and they all work. Disregard that the port has extra pins. Just connect your TV and notebook with a straight S-Video cable, that should the trick for you.
the go to properties on desktop - settings - enable screen 2 and you are moving.
Remember to set your TV to SVIDEO in not just video -

i tried a svideo cable but the display came out black and white on my tv screen ??????
any ideas why -
may be incorrect AV-setting on your tv... both mine have a number AV "channels" some are black and white versions of other coloured channels
-
i got it working from black and white to colour, i just changed the tv out format to PAL because i have a PAL tv set, its easy to do you can either do it in the built in nvidia nview tv tuner tool or download a nvidia bios tool and change it in there. worked fine for me
